
刷新一排Excel数据的方法包括:使用手动刷新、使用公式重新计算、使用宏和VBA、利用数据连接、使用Power Query。
其中,手动刷新是最简单也是最直观的方法。你只需要选中你需要刷新的那一排数据,然后按下F9键即可重新计算并刷新数据。这个方法适合小规模的数据刷新,操作简单,效果明显。接下来,我们将详细讨论这些方法及其实现步骤。
一、手动刷新
手动刷新是通过直接操作Excel界面来实现数据的更新。这种方法适用于用户需要快速更新数据而不涉及复杂的操作步骤。
1. 选择数据范围
首先,打开你的Excel文件,找到你需要刷新的那一排数据。通过鼠标点击并拖动来选中这一排的数据单元格。
2. 使用快捷键
选中数据后,按下键盘上的F9键。F9键在Excel中用于重新计算所有公式,这样可以确保选中的数据得到刷新。需要注意的是,F9键重新计算的是整个工作表中的所有公式,如果你只想刷新某一行的数据,可以配合其他方法使用。
二、公式重新计算
公式重新计算是通过修改或重新输入公式来实现数据更新。这种方法适用于数据依赖于公式计算的情况。
1. 确认公式
首先,确保你需要刷新的那一排数据是通过公式计算得出的。检查每个单元格,确认其中包含公式。
2. 修改公式
在需要刷新的单元格中,轻微修改公式并按Enter键,这样Excel会重新计算并更新数据。例如,如果公式是=SUM(A1:A10),你可以暂时改为=SUM(A1:A9),然后再改回来。
3. 自动刷新
如果你的Excel文件设置了自动计算模式,那么每次修改公式后,数据都会自动刷新。你可以在Excel选项中确认这一设置:点击“文件”-“选项”-“公式”,确保“自动”选项被选中。
三、使用宏和VBA
宏和VBA(Visual Basic for Applications)提供了更高级的数据刷新功能,适合需要定期更新大规模数据的情况。
1. 编写宏
打开Excel,按下Alt + F11进入VBA编辑器。点击“插入”-“模块”,在新模块中输入以下代码:
Sub RefreshRow()
Rows("1:1").Calculate
End Sub
这段代码将刷新第一行的数据,你可以根据需要修改行号。
2. 运行宏
返回Excel界面,按下Alt + F8,选择你刚刚创建的宏“RefreshRow”,然后点击“运行”。这样,第一行的数据将被刷新。
3. 自动化宏
你可以设置宏在特定时间或事件发生时自动运行。例如,可以在工作簿打开时自动刷新数据。将以下代码添加到ThisWorkbook对象中:
Private Sub Workbook_Open()
Call RefreshRow
End Sub
四、利用数据连接
数据连接使得Excel可以从外部数据源获取数据,并在数据源更新时自动刷新。这种方法适用于需要实时数据更新的情况。
1. 创建数据连接
打开Excel,点击“数据”选项卡,选择“获取数据”-“从文件”-“从工作簿”。选择外部数据源文件并导入数据。
2. 设置刷新选项
导入数据后,点击“数据”选项卡中的“属性”,在弹出的对话框中设置刷新选项。你可以选择在打开文件时刷新数据,或设定定时刷新间隔。
3. 刷新数据
在需要刷新数据时,点击“数据”选项卡中的“刷新全部”按钮,Excel将从外部数据源重新获取数据并更新。
五、使用Power Query
Power Query是Excel中的强大工具,可以用来连接、整理和更新数据。适用于复杂数据处理和多数据源整合的情况。
1. 导入数据
打开Excel,点击“数据”选项卡,选择“获取数据”-“从文件”-“从工作簿”。选择需要导入的数据文件,点击“导入”。
2. 编辑查询
导入数据后,Power Query编辑器会自动打开。你可以在编辑器中对数据进行整理和转换操作。完成后,点击“关闭并加载”,数据将被导入Excel。
3. 刷新数据
在需要刷新数据时,点击“数据”选项卡中的“刷新全部”按钮,Excel将重新执行Power Query查询并更新数据。
通过以上五种方法,你可以根据具体情况选择最适合的方式来刷新Excel数据,从而提高工作效率,确保数据的准确性和实时性。
相关问答FAQs:
1. 如何在Excel中刷新一整行的数据?
要刷新一整行的数据,可以按照以下步骤进行操作:
- 首先,选中需要刷新的行。
- 接下来,右键点击所选行,然后选择“刷新”选项。
- Excel会立即刷新所选行的数据,并显示最新的信息。
2. 我如何在Excel中刷新一排数据中的某一列?
若要刷新一排数据中的某一列,可以按照以下步骤进行:
- 首先,选中需要刷新的列。
- 接下来,右键点击所选列,然后选择“刷新”选项。
- Excel会立即刷新所选列的数据,并显示最新的信息。
3. 如何在Excel中自动刷新一排数据?
若想在Excel中实现自动刷新一排数据的功能,可按照以下步骤进行设置:
- 首先,在需要刷新的数据行中选择一个单元格。
- 接下来,点击Excel菜单栏上的“数据”选项。
- 在“数据”选项中,选择“刷新全部”或者“刷新数据”。
- Excel会自动定期刷新所选行的数据,并显示最新的信息。
希望以上解答能帮助到您,如有其他问题,请随时提问。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4683386